Modelling Team — Claude Code Skill
A Claude Code skill that builds polished Excel financial models via a three-agent team: Architect (Opus) designs the blueprint, Coder (Sonnet) writes Python/openpyxl, Challenger (Opus) stress-tests formulas. Supports light (single-tab) and heavy (multi-tab with Dashboard, scenario selector, INDEX-driven scenarios) modes.
How It Works
User request
|
v
Step 0: Clarify scope (heavy or light?)
|
v
Step 1: MODEL ARCHITECT (Opus)
Designs full model blueprint: tabs, rows, formulas, scenarios
|
v
Step 2: MODEL CODER (Sonnet)
Translates blueprint into Python/openpyxl script, runs it
|
v
Step 3: MODEL CHALLENGER (Opus)
Reviews .xlsx: formula audit, scenario validation, design check
|
v
PASS -> deliver | FAIL -> fix and re-check (up to 3 iterations)
Features
- Two modes: Light (single tab, assumptions at top) and Heavy (Dashboard + Assumptions + calculation tabs)
- Scenario selector (heavy mode): Dashboard cell drives Low/Base/High via
INDEX()— no hardcoded scenario columns - Professional design language: Navy/blue palette, Arial font, color-coded cells (blue = inputs, black = formulas, green = cross-sheet links)
- Manual extensibility: All formulas use proper
$-notation (mixed/absolute references) so you can drag formulas to new columns - IRR/NPV/PBP/DPBP: Correctly constructed cash flow streams with negative initial investment
- Zero formula errors: Challenger validates every formula before delivery

Usage
Just ask Claude Code to build a model:
"Build me a DCF model for a coffee shop: $200K revenue, 5% growth, 30% EBITDA margin, 10% discount rate, 4x terminal multiple, 5-year horizon."
"Build me a heavy model for a rental portfolio with 3 properties, scenario analysis for rent growth and vacancy, and a dashboard with IRR and cash-on-cash return."
Claude will ask whether you want a light or heavy model, then run the three-agent workflow automatically.

Design Language
The skill enforces a consistent visual style across all models:
| Element | Color | Usage |
|---|---|---|
Blue font (0000FF) |
Inputs | Editable assumptions |
Black font (000000) |
Formulas | All calculations |
Green font (008000) |
Cross-sheet | Links between tabs |
Navy fill (1F3864) |
Title rows | Model/section titles |
Medium blue fill (2F5496) |
Section headers | Sub-sections |
Light blue fill (EBF3FB) |
Input cells | Background for editable cells |
Light green fill (E2EFDA) |
Totals/KPIs | Bold summary rows |
